Community Feel: The area around Kennels Court is typically suburban, characterized by quiet streets, family homes, and a strong sense of community. It's a place where neighbors often know each other, and there is a focus on creating a safe and welcoming environment. Proximity to Amenities: The neighborhood is conveniently close to several key amenities, including schools, parks, and shopping centers. Camp Creek Marketplace, a large shopping area with various stores, restaurants, and entertainment options, is just a short drive away. Access to Transportation: East Point is well-connected by major highways, such as I-285 and I-85, making it easy to commute to other parts of Atlanta and the surrounding areas. Public transportation options, including MARTA (Metropolitan Atlanta Rapid Transit Authority), are also available, providing further connectivity .Local Parks and Recreation: The area features several parks and green spaces, such as Sykes Park and Brookdale Park, which offer opportunities for outdoor activities like walking, jogging, and picnicking. These spaces contribute to the neighborhood's family-friendly atmosphere.
